瀏覽代碼

专辑fix

haonan 1 年之前
父節點
當前提交
001fe1927c

+ 2 - 1
cooleshow-user/user-admin/src/main/java/com/yonge/cooleshow/admin/controller/TenantAlbumController.java

@@ -131,6 +131,7 @@ public class TenantAlbumController {
                 MusicSheetVo musicSheet = idMsMap.getOrDefault(musicSheetId, new MusicSheetVo());
                 tenantAlbumSheet.setMusicSheetName(musicSheet.getMusicSheetName());
                 tenantAlbumSheet.setMusicTag(musicSheet.getMusicTag());
+                tenantAlbumSheet.setComposer(musicSheet.getComposer());
                 return tenantAlbumSheet;
             }).collect(Collectors.toList());
 
@@ -164,7 +165,7 @@ public class TenantAlbumController {
     @PostMapping("/update")
     @ApiOperation(value = "修改专辑", notes = "修改专辑")
     @PreAuthorize("@pcs.hasPermissions('tenantAlbum/update')")
-    public HttpResponseResult<Boolean> update(@Validated @RequestBody TenantAlbumVo.TenantAlbum album) {
+    public HttpResponseResult<Boolean> update( @RequestBody TenantAlbumVo.TenantAlbum album) {
         TenantAlbum tenantAlbum = JSON.parseObject(album.jsonString(), TenantAlbum.class);
         List<TenantAlbumVo.MusicSheetData> musicSheetData = album.getMusicSheetData();
 

+ 1 - 1
cooleshow-user/user-biz/src/main/java/com/yonge/cooleshow/biz/dal/service/impl/TenantAlbumServiceImpl.java

@@ -303,7 +303,7 @@ public class TenantAlbumServiceImpl extends ServiceImpl<TenantAlbumMapper, Tenan
 
         tenantAlbumMusicService.lambdaUpdate()
                 .set(TenantAlbumMusic::getDelFlag, true)
-                .eq(TenantAlbumMusic::getTenantAlbumId, tenantAlbum)
+                .eq(TenantAlbumMusic::getTenantAlbumId, tenantAlbum.getId())
                 .eq(TenantAlbumMusic::getTenantId, tenantId)
                 .update();